Brazil - Female Secondary Education School Age Population

Since 2009, Brazil Female Secondary Education School Age Population fell by 0.6% year on year. With 11,566,706 Persons in 2014, the country was number 7 among other countries in Female Secondary Education School Age Population. Brazil is overtaken by United States, which was number 6 with 12,006,403.98 Persons and is followed by Bangladesh with 11,411,249.12 Persons. India topped the ranking with 84,623,242.81 Persons in 2019, an increase of 0.5% compared to 2018. China, Indonesia and Pakistan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Gambia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+4.3% per year, while Latvia witnessed the worst performance at -10.4% per year.
